E.A.1. Improved national capacities for assessing methane emissions in Upstream Oil and Gas, and in Downstream Gas industries. A1.1 Assessment of methane emissions in Upstream Oil and Gas, and in Downstream Gas industries in the UNECE member States

$17,000

1. Consultant hired (work on assessment of methane emissions in Upstream Oil and Gas, and in Downstream Gas industries in the UNECE member States in progress - to be completed by Q1 2019) 

Approx. $7,000
E.A.2. Improved knowledge about strategies, techniques and methods for MRV and reduction of methane emissions in Upstream Oil and Gas, and in Downstream Gas industries in the UNECE Member States. A2.1 Development of case studies (5-10 pages-long) (i.e., by company, emission source, industry segment, and/or country) for MRV of methane emissions in Upstream Oil and Gas, and in Downstream Gas industries  $20,000
